The Practice
Write down 13 things, ideas, goals, foci that you want to call in throughout 2025. You’re going to take the pieces of paper and fold them and place them in a jar, a box, an envelope, a pouch or something that closes. You can start any day you’d like. Vanessa the Wonder Worker said if you’re pagan, you can start on the winter solstice, if you’re Christian you can start on the 24th of December. It really doesn’t matter what day you start or what religious/cultural affiliation you are, all that matters is your intention.
What we did was write all the wishes on a piece of paper that we haven’t unwrapped because the year isn’t over. Once it is, I’ll let you know what came through for us. We’ll likely have a ritual for this unveiling in the New Year.
Zoom in and see that we have ‘ocean’ and ‘oatmeal’ in there. Those were definitely present throughout 2024. :)
The next day, you have your 13 wishes and take one out of the jar or box and keep it unread and burn it. Placing the fire and sending the smoke to the universe to make it happen for you. Source, the universe, God, the unseen, your angels and ancestors are responsible for making this wish come true.
Every day for the next 12 days, you will burn one of those pieces of paper. Make this however in depth or light as you’d like. Have fun with it though, none of this is meant to be serious. Plus the more emotion you place into each ritual, the more the quantum leap happens instantly.
You will be left with one piece, one wish. You get to read this one because it is your responsibility to make this one come to reality.
